About Springfield Golf Club
For more than 75 years, Leroy Springs & Company, Inc. has provided affordable, quality recreation and community activities and facilities in the region home to the historic Springs Cotton Mills. What Is the Cost of Living Near Rock Hill?

Understanding the cost of living near Rock Hill is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Springfield Golf Club.
Rock Hill's Cost of Living Index is approximately 91.3 (8.7% less expensive than US average; 4.2% less than SC average). Charlotte suburb (York Co.), more affordable housing than Charlotte. My Ride.
